I ponder the option of releasing a few prisoners. But how (if at all) can I recapture them afterwards?
That's why I generally don't invoke NQ. You can keep on taking prisoners and then release them to the wild. Just make sure you don't leave behind and SWs or unscrounged wrecks.

By invoking NQ you give your opponent an "out" as they can then route away even if interdicted.

Mind you, my opponent once released one of my prisoners, and then I rolled a 1,1 and rearmed them. Caused merry havoc in his rear areas. So it can bite you in the bum sometimes.

If they pick up a SW, then they are armed and no longer protected...
Is that so?

A20.53 states: "Abandoned prisoners are still subject to the protection of 20.3-.4 (i.e., an abandoned prisoner subsequently eliminated by the side that abandoned it causes the Massacre rule to take immediate effect)." There's no distinction between armed and unarmed here.

The only Q&A I could find states that prisoners are not protected after they have rearmed according to A20.551, but then, they are replaced by a green/conscript counter anyways and are no longer abandoned prisoners, but are treated as every other squad.
